The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 76018 zip code. The total population is 28553, of which, 13620 are male and 14933 are female. With a total area of 19.838 square miles, the population density is 1572.7 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 31.3 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 76018 zip code is $75748. This is 16.55% greater than the national average. This income places 12.1%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$20286. Education
In the 76018 zip code, 83.4%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 25.6%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 76018 zip, there are an estimated 16557 people in the labor force, of which, 15669 are employed, and 888 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 28.3 minutes. Of the total people that work, 911 worked from home and 15521 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 39.6. Housing
The median home value for the 76018 zip code is 177500. There is an estimated 8375 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$1650 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$1338.
